Earlier on Tuesday, the king cryptocurrency had broken past the psychological barrier of 50,000 for the first time in Bitcoin history. But the coin quickly fell minutes after before it could hold on to $50k. With this new rise, the coin is now in a “parabolic advance.” The fourth time in the twelve year history of the king cryptocurrency.
Peter Brandt confirmed that the coin is now in a “parabolic advance” in a tweet:
Big picture BTC Bitcoin is undergoing its third parabolic advance in the past decade, A parabolic advance on an arithmetic scale is extremely rare — three on a log scale is historic.
Dan Held, Kraken’s growth lead noted that if counting its initial phase prior to 2012, there have been four parabolic advances.
Brandt noted that if this advance is violated, a correction of about 80% should be expected. A bearish consequence as was observed in 2018 after Bitcoin peaked at near $20,000. After this advance was violated, the coin fell to $3,100 a year later.

According to the head of trading at BlockTower Capital, Avi Felman, MicroStrategy’s announcement of a plan to purchase $600 million BTC was to trigger Bitcoin into breaking the psychological barrier of $50,000. On December 7, 2020, the firm made a similar announcement that forced Bitcoin to break the major hurdle of $20,000. The business intelligence firm has been buying bitcoin since August 2020 and is sitting on a profit of more than $2 billion on its holdings.
